Northeast Greenland National Park, Greenland: Covering an astonishing 972,000 square kilometers, Northeast Greenland National Park holds the title as the world's largest national park. This Arctic wilderness is a haven for polar bears, musk oxen, and migratory birds. Its glaciers, fjords, and ice caps offer a glimpse into the Earth's frozen realms. 2.
